CLASSIFICATION OF THE SUBSTANCE OR MIXTURE According to Regulation (EC) No 1272/2008 [CLP] Acute Tox. 4 (oral) Eye Dam./Irrit. 2 Skin Sens. 1 Carc. 2 Page: 2/20 BASF Safety data sheet according to Regulation (EC) No. 1907/2006 Date / Revised: 21.11.2013 Version: 2.0 Product: ADEXAR (ID no. 30519170/SDS_CPA_GB/EN) Date of print 23.11.2013 Repr. 2 (fertility) Repr. 2 (unborn child) Aquatic Acute 1 Aquatic Chronic 1 According to Directive 67/548/EEC or 1999/45/EC Carc. Cat. 3 Repr. Cat. 3 Possible Hazards: Harmful if swallowed. Irritating to eyes. Limited evidence of a carcinogenic effect. May cause sensitization by skin contact. Possible risk of impaired fertility. Possible risk of harm to the unborn child. Very toxic to aquatic organisms, may cause long-term adverse effects in the aquatic environment.
